</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Make it a great weekend!</span></b></div>Buck Weberhttp://www.blogger.com/profile/01539959664771740038noreply@blogger.com0t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5180775026297039691.post-27935497833524569082011-06-22T13:03:00.000-05:002011-06-22T13:03:57.818-05:00How to Save Serious Money on Vacation<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;"><a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EjTLShyT43m86DImXrzpFzf9X85G7kJdWc_onke3D34YcOSMEq9eFcnmvfaBcPSCSJqcMzXIBbGykqYOGFlNC7wWKKkfobBrjSLisJuztZcVQHcyAcqRD3GSAIpOHX5qxLEMkIFJpbaRA7M/s1600/vacation.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: left; cssfloat: left; float: left;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" height="104px" i$="true"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EjTLShyT43m86DImXrzpFzf9X85G7kJdWc_onke3D34YcOSMEq9eFcnmvfaBcPSCSJqcMzXIBbGykqYOGFlNC7wWKKkfobBrjSLisJuztZcVQHcyAcqRD3GSAIpOHX5qxLEMkIFJpbaRA7M/s200/vacation.jpg" width="200px" /></a></div><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Over the years my wife and kids and I have been fortunate enough to be able to afford, and take the time off, for some pretty memorable vacations. We have camped all over our state of Iowa as well as quite a few surrounding states. We have vacationed in the Black Hills, the Grand Teton Mountains and the Rockies, just for some highlights. During all these vacations (and the extensive preparations for them) we got to be pretty good at staying within a small budget. Following are some of the ways we learned to travel and lodge frugally while still having a good time. These tips are primarily for those that travel by car, so if you like planes, trains, bikes, busses or boats they might not work for you.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Bring Your Own Food</span></b><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> – Depending on how long you will be gone, and how many there are, you might be able to cover the whole trip. We have been able to survive for a week with very few additional supplements to our menu (2 adults and 2 kids) before we had to break down and hit a local grocery store. We would take along food that didn’t need to be warmed such as salads, the fixings for sandwiches, cold chicken, chicken strips to make wraps, chips, fruit, etc. We would also budget in a few restaurant stops to break up the routine. Hey, it’s a vacation, not boot camp! </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Cook Your Own Meals</span></b><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> – This one is usually not a problem when tent or RV camping, but it is worth asking if it is allowed before booking a stay in a cabin or hotel. Most of the cabins we have stayed in would allow cooking inside (many had their own kitchens) while a hotel will usually only allow you to warm up food in the microwave, so plan accordingly. If we know we will be able to cook inside we always pack our electric skillet, in our experiences the single most versatile cooking appliance.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Stay In a Central Location</span></b><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> – Many times when planning our vacations we would decide what attractions we wanted to see and then try to find a place to stay that was centered among them. That way we could stay in one cabin, hotel or campsite for several days and not have to move while making small road trips in different directions to take in the sites.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span></span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Travel In the Off Season</span></b><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> – If you have kids in school this might not be an option unless you can plan time off around teacher in service days or holiday weekends. If kids are not a problem you could save a nice percentage off of hotel and cabin stays, as well as some attractions. Check the web to find what the off season is for where you want to go. </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Reward Programs and Membership Discounts </span></b><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">– Reward programs and membership discounts are offered by airlines, hotels, gas stations and AAA. Also make sure to check </span><a href="http://www.groupon.com/"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Groupon</span></a><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> for discounts to restaurants, museums and other attractions where you will be visiting. </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Have Your Car Tuned Up</span></b><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> – There is nothing like breaking down in a strange town, or worse, in the middle of nowhere to kill the vacation mood, and if it is something serious the time and money spent to fix it could even kill the whole vacation. While some things can’t be planned for budgeting for a tune up just before you leave is well worth the money. It won’t hurt to also tell your mechanic where you are going, as he might pay special attention to certain parts. For example: do your breaks have plenty of life left, because you use them a lot while driving in the mountains? Or, will your vehicle coolant be able to handle desert temperatures and do you have decent tires for inclement weather?</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/>

</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">Each year, Forbes magazine publishes a list of the wealthiest people in the world.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Of course, the names at the top of the list are household names—Warren Buffet and Bill Gates.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Forbes rates the wealthiest people in the world by their net worth.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Net worth is simply a person’s total assets minus their liabilities.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Although you may not be fighting to get your name on the Forbes’ list, chances are good that you have a definite interest in building your net worth.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">Practical Step to Building Net Worth</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">Let’s return to the definition of net worth once more.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>It is defined as a person’s assets minus their liabilities. Now, this is important to understand.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>It doesn’t really matter how many assets a person has.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>If they have too many liabilities, the inflated assets will not mean anything.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>We see this play out in the business world all the time.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>A company may have hundreds of millions of dollars in assets, but it attempts to expand too fast and takes on unsustainable debts, which are liabilities.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>In corporate America, this eventually leads to bankruptcy.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>A company that has hundreds of millions of dollars in assets, but also has $2 billion in outstanding liabilities, is headed for total collapse.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Thus, the way to build net worth is not to necessarily focus on building assets or a </span><a href="http://www.forextraders.com/forex-account.html"><span style="color: blue; font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">forex account</span></a><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">, but to rather eliminate liabilities.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">Eliminating Liabilities</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">The three primary liabilities that most middle-class Americans have are a mortgage, a car loan, and credit card debt.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>The real way to build true, lasting wealth is to focus on eliminating the most destructive of these three types of liabilities—credit card debt.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">Credit card debt is a major hindrance of wealth creation.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Ultimately, it is wise to buy assets in order to build net worth.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>When hundreds of dollars are being spent each month paying credit cards off, this money could be going toward purchasing those assets.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Thus, one of the first steps that must be taken to </span><a href="http://www.smartmoney.com/personal-finance/retirement/start-with-10000-and-retire-a-millionaire-1302199246299/"><span style="color: blue; font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">build real wealth</span></a><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;"> is to pay off all credit card debts in order to eliminate this liability.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">Adjust the Budget</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ia", "serif"; font-size: 12pt; mso-fareast-font-family: Calibri;">The most practical way to quickly pay off credit card debt is to honestly analyze your monthly spending habits and discover every area that could be cut back and eliminated.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>Once you find out how much can be eliminated each month, then decide to shift this extra capital toward paying down your credit card debt.<span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>This will not necessarily be fun and exciting, but it will help put you into a place of financial strength once the liability is eliminated and you can direct that extra capital into purchasing assets.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/>

</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">With gas prices rising and the job market and economy unstable, most people are doing whatever they can to save money. There are some big changes people can make, such as renting a cheaper apartment, or small changes such as brown bagging lunches instead of eating out. Even people with small incomes can usually find a way to save, and small savings add up. Even just $10 per month adds up to $120 per year. The savings add up even faster if they are earning interest in a savings or investment account.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Rent a Smaller Apartment</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Renting an apartment is a great way to save money. Renter's insurance is usually way cheaper than homeowner's insurance. The </span><a href="http://www.rentersinsurance.net/michigan.html"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">National Association of Insurance Commissioners</span></a><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> reported that rental insurance in Michigan costs an average of $164 year. This breaks down to just $13.67 per month. According to the Insurance Institute of Michigan, average premiums for homeowners insurance in MI were $797 in 2004. This breaks down to about $66.42 per month. If you are already renting, moving to a smaller place will usually result in lower monthly rent and lower utility costs because there is less space to heat and cool. There are many </span><a href="http://www.rentedmonton.com/Default.aspx"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Edmonton</span></a><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> apartments for rent that are in great locations and have low monthly rental fees. </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Budget</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Creating a budget is important whether the income level is $1,000 per month or $8,000 per month. Listing all monthly bills with amounts and due dates paints an accurate picture of your finances. Treating savings like a bill is important. There should be a line in the budget for savings, even if it's only $25 per month. Budgeting also gives consumers an idea of how much money they have available after the essential bills. It helps people to not overspend when they know there is only $75 a week in the budget for groceries, for example.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Pay Off Debt</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">According to </span><a href="http://outlawfinance.com/how-to-save-money-on-a-low-income/"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Outlaw Finance</span></a><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;"> freeing yourself of debt is one of the first steps you should take. Paying extra on your debts is will free up money faster and you will pay out less money in interest and fees. When one credit card is paid off, the payment you were making can be put toward the next debt to get it paid off sooner. Talking to credit card companies may not help, but it won't hurt. The companies may agree to lower interest rates or take less money than you owe in a lump sum payment. Credit card companies can be difficult to work with, but they don't want you to go bankrupt, so they will sometimes work with you on a payment plan. </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Taking back items that still have tags on them or having a garage sale is a quick way to make money for debt payment. Many people are selling used items on online auction sites for extra money. It may not seem like much at first, but any payment that is more than the minimum usually goes straight to lowering the total amount owed. </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Invest in a 401K</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Having money taken out of each paycheck before it's deposited is a great way to save. This money is not part of the budget, so it's easier not to spend it on something else. Increasing 401k contributions with each raise adds even more money to savings without making a dent in your monthly budget. Many companies have a fund set aside to match the amount of money that employees deposit into their 401k accounts, up to a certain percentage. Talk to the human resources department of your company if you're unsure about a company match. This is free money that employees often turn down by not investing.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Set Goals</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Saving money can be difficult, especially for people who need most of their income for necessary bills like rent, food, and gas. Setting a goal to save for something you really want makes it easier to save money. For example, people may be faced with the decision to buy a new pair of shoes or save that $75 toward the car they really want. Having pictures of the savings goal in prominent places will remind you what you're saving for. It's also helpful to break down the goal into manageable amounts per month. If the goal is to have $5,000 saved in a year from now, this breaks down to $416.67 per month or $96.15 per week.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Trim Expenses</span></b></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Even small amounts of money add up. If someone spends $2 every week on movie rentals, this money adds up to $104 after one year. Switching to a cheaper cell phone or TV plan is another way to save money. Many people are not using the services they are paying for and can easily make cuts.</span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/>
</div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t;">Eating out is one expense that most people can cut. Bringing lunch to work instead of buying lunch every day can save most people around $50 per week. Eating out is a social event for many people. Inviting friends over for dinner or drinks and rotating houses each month is a fun way to spend time with friends and save money. Soup and bread is a meal that feeds a large amount of people on a small budget. It's also nice to not have people you don't know interrupting the conversation of your group. Your house never closes, so friends can talk all night if they want to. </span></div><div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><br />

<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Over the past few months, several states have been pushing legislation designed to tax online businesses. While online companies already pay state sales taxes to the state of their headquarters, <a href="http://www.opencongress.org/bill/111-h5660/show"><span style="mso-ascii-font-family: Georgia; mso-hansi-font-family: Georgia;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">The Main Street Fairness Act</span></span></a>, as named by Illinois Senator Dick Durbin (D), proposes to collect taxes on all purchases made in states that have company affiliates.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">For example, companies like <a href="http://www.amazon.com/"><span style="mso-ascii-font-family: Georgia; mso-hansi-font-family: Georgia;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Amazon.com</span></span></a> with affiliates in Illinois, which already has the Fairness Act in effect, will experience tax for all sales to Illinois residents. Amazon severed its ties with affiliates in Illinois immediately after the bill, to escape the effects of the law.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Many fear that the effects of this bill nationwide will cause some companies to leave the United States, thus removing jobs from the company. Others are worried that the tax will decrease spending and destroy online retailers.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Proponents of the tax argue that tax-free online sales give an unfair advantage to Internet retailers that don't maintain operations in every state. And with some retail businesses closing down their brick-and-mortar locations but continuing online sales, states are looking for ways like this to retain any revenue possible.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">I'm by no means a member or supporter of the Tea Party Movement. In fact, I support taxes in most cases. But this bill poses some problems that are a bit more alarming than simply paying another sales tax. <o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Think about the pros and cons of shopping online versus in a store. In a store, you get to test and touch merchandise, you have the item in your possession as soon as you buy it, and you can easily return it by going back to the store. Online, you have many resources for research and comparison (although those with smartphones have these in stores as well), but you have to pay for shipping, wait for the product to ship, and deal with the hassle of return-shipping if something is broken. <o:p></o:p></span><br />
<br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Consider how the added sales tax will affect people's shopping habits. There would be no benefit to shopping online unless online vendors had extremely low prices. Otherwise, you're pretty much paying the same price or more to have something shipped to your home instead of having it immediately once you leave a store.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Online retailers would also have to use more resources to simply comply with the bill. Online companies would be flooded with significant paperwork and periodic audits regarding all the new taxes from each state; this might be enough to make online retail simply out of the question for small or up-and-coming businesses.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">While this proposed bill is aimed at providing fairness for small local business, its biggest supporters and lobbyers are paid by huge brick-and-mortar retailers like <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/al-norman/walmart-sales-tax_b_846986.html"><span style="mso-ascii-font-family: Georgia; mso-hansi-font-family: Georgia;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Wal-Mart</span></span></a>. This is yet another reason to question who this bill will really help and whether it's worth the amount of businesses it may significantly hurt.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/>

<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">Carl Hamilton (1914 – 1991) served as vice president and administrator of Iowa State University, was an editor and publisher and late in life wrote about Iowa history and his own memories of growing up on an Iowa farm. The following excerpts are from one of his books, In No Time At All, and follow the lifespan of a mail order catalog on the farm.<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">“When the average farm home, uncluttered by radio or television, had only a weekly and possibly a daily newspaper and some magazines, the arrival of a Montgomery Ward or Sears and Roebuck catalog was a major event.” <o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">“It was carefully studied by parents as they compared prices in their never-ending struggle to match resources with necessities. “Making out the order” was a project that might go on for some weeks and would include everything from long underwear to farm tools. Clearly desires must have been stimulated beyond means by the long hours of studying the vast array of merchandise with prices which ranged from Good to Better to Best.”<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">“The arrival of the catalog was even more of an event for the kids. Hours and hours of long winter evenings and rainy Sunday afternoons were spent thumbing through the catalog – a page at a time!”<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/>
<div class="MsoNoSpacing" style="margin: 0in 0in 0pt;"><span style="font-family: "Georgia","serif"; font-size: 12pt;">“But what an ignominious end it had. One so in keeping with the times: waste nothing! Where did that valued, much-treasured book end up? In the privy! There, of course, it served a double purpose. It served as “tissue” – although hardly of the scented, soft textured brands of milady’s toilette. Also it provided one last chance to review the well-studied pages. And, providing the weather was right, meaning it wasn’t so cold as to bring chilblains to unaccustomed places or so warm as to encourage flies, the catalog added interest to that interlude in the day’s activities. Of course, it did have limitations even for that final purpose. Even under the most extreme circumstances, when nothing was being wasted, the slick paper sections did leave something to be desired as “tissue.” There came a time when the remains – the high fashion section – was consigned en masse to the lower regions! Ker-plop!”<o:p></o:p></span></div><br />

<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;">Taking the entire family out to eat can turn into a very expensive event. Fortunately, there are several restaurants that offer free meal specials for kids. Taking advantage of kids' meal deals can make family meals out more fun and frequent, and it will be easier on the wallet at the same time. </span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;">The following are 10 popular restaurants that offer free meals for kids. Some of these offers may vary depending on location, and not all restaurants may participate. It's always a good idea to call ahead of time to verify information with your local restaurants--this will save you time and money. </span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.goldencorral.net/locator/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Golden Corral</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>At Golden Corral, children ages three and under can eat for free from the buffet with the purchase of one adult meal. This offer is good every day. On Mondays from 5:00 p.m. to 9:00 p.m., kids ages 10 and under can eat for free. Two kids can eat for free for every adult meal that is purchased.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.dennys.com/en/default.aspx?title=Denny%27s+Home"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Denny's</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;"> </span>- </b>On select nights that vary by location and restaurant participation, kids ages 10 and under can eat for free between the hours of 4:00 p.m. to 10:00 p.m. For every two kids eating free, one adult meal ($2.50 or more) must be purchased. Check with your local Denny's restaurant to find out which night this special is offered.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.ihop.com/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Times New Roman;">IHOP</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>On Monday evenings, from 4:00 p.m. to 8:00 p.m., IHOP offers specials for children 12 and under. For every adult entrée purchased, one child can eat for free. Beverages cost extra and are not included in the free meal. </span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.quiznos.com/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Quiznos</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>At participating Quiznos locations, with the purchase of one adult meal, one Quiznos Kidz meal is free. This offer is for kids ages 12 and under--and the day that this special is offered varies depending on location.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.chick-fil-a.com/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Chick-fil-A</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>Tuesday nights at Chick-fil-A are family fun nights! On Tuesdays only, one kids meal is free per every adult combo meal purchased. </span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.mariecallenders.com/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Marie Callender's</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>Select Marie Callender's restaurants offer kids ages 12 and under free meals. One kids meal is free for every adult meal purchased.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.planetsub.com/flash.html"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Planet Sub</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>On Tuesday evening from 4:00 p.m. until close, one kids meal per one adult meal purchase is free. This offer is good for kids ages 11 and under.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.damons.com/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Damon's</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>At Damon's Sports Bar & Grill, Wednesday night is "kids' night!" With every adult meal purchased, one kid's meal is free.</span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.applebees.com/"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Applebees</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"> - </b>On Monday night at Applebees, kids can eat for free. With the purchase of one adult meal, one child's meal is free. If only one adult is present, each additional child's meal costs only $1. </span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al" style="margin: 0in 0in 10pt;">
<span style="font-family: 'Georgia','serif'; font-size: 12pt; line-height: 115%;"><a href="http://www.cicispizza.com/_template.php"><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="color: blue; font-family: Georgia, "Times New Roman", serif;">Cici's Pizza</span></b></a><b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"><span style="mso-spacerun: yes;"> </span>- </b>At Cici's Pizza, children ages three and under can eat for free from the buffet. This offer is good all day every day. Some locations also offer free meals to older kids on specific days of the week--call your local Cici's Pizza and find out more details. <b style="mso-bidi-font-weight: normal;"></b></span></div>
